Patent attributes
A method for cancelling seat vibration includes receiving, from an accelerometer, a plurality of accelerometer measurements and applying a first filter to the plurality of accelerometer measurements to remove accelerometer measurements of the plurality of accelerometer measurements having a frequency above a first threshold frequency. The method also includes applying a second filter to an output of the first filter to remove accelerometer measurements of the output of the first filter having a frequency above a second threshold frequency and applying a third filter to an output of the second filter to generate an accelerometer measurement output having a center frequency corresponding to a resonant frequency of the vibration of the at least one component of the seat. The method also includes determining an absolute magnitude value of the accelerometer measurement output and selectively controlling a motor based on the absolute magnitude value of the accelerometer measurement output.